When less is more
Producing large ductile iron axle housings can be a challenging task. The part shown above was well into production when a shrinkage defect was noticed during machining. After several attempts to find a solution, the foundry contacted MAGMA to evaluate the part design.

Getting it right the first time
Risering of castings is supported through the determination of the local thermal modulus. This modulus describes the relationship between the heat content of a volume and the cooling power of the surrounding surfaces.
